Transaction 63144067eb49dc2500f91b5f22070a323e69ea7c035fdf9e6c7b4170cbbae3e0
2 Input
2 Outputs
- 63144067eb49dc2500f91b5f22070a323e69ea7c035fdf9e6c7b4170cbbae3e0:0
- 63144067eb49dc2500f91b5f22070a323e69ea7c035fdf9e6c7b4170cbbae3e0:1
value 22543
address 12WTYYae7iXNy6Sh8rs9XgRAaYCT5bVbj4
value 127267
address 16DfZvPYrRtGfczgSSCCJNfFUXovrg6qzm